IMaterializationInterceptor.CreatedInstance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Chiamato immediatamente dopo che EF ha creato un'istanza di un'entità. Ovvero, dopo che il costruttore è stato chiamato, ma prima che siano stati impostati valori di proprietà non impostati dal costruttore.
public virtual object CreatedInstance (Microsoft.EntityFrameworkCore.Diagnostics.MaterializationInterceptionData materializationData, object entity);
abstract member CreatedInstance : Microsoft.EntityFrameworkCore.Diagnostics.MaterializationInterceptionData * obj -> obj
override this.CreatedInstance : Microsoft.EntityFrameworkCore.Diagnostics.MaterializationInterceptionData * obj -> obj
Public Overridable Function CreatedInstance (materializationData As MaterializationInterceptionData, entity As Object) As Object
Parametri
- materializationData
- MaterializationInterceptionData
Informazioni contestuali sulla materializzazione in corso.
- entity
- Object
Istanza dell'entità creata. Questo valore viene in genere usato come valore restituito per l'implementazione di questo metodo.
Restituisce
Istanza dell'entità che ef userà.
Un'implementazione di questo metodo per qualsiasi intercettore che non tenta di modificare l'istanza utilizzata deve restituire il entity
valore passato.